Understanding Alexandria’s Historic Construction

Why Historic Experience Matters

Alexandria is one of the oldest cities in Virginia, with many homes and commercial structures dating back well over 100 years.

Construction in Alexandria often involves dealing with historic brick foundations, aging mortar systems, settlement conditions, older drainage methods, and materials that behave very differently from modern construction products.

A contractor working in Alexandria must understand how older structures were originally built and why certain materials fail over time.

Modern construction shortcuts can severely damage historic structures if improper repair methods are used.

For example, many historic Alexandria brick buildings were constructed using softer brick and lime-based mortar systems.

If a contractor improperly repoints those joints using overly hard modern mortar, the brick itself can begin failing.

The mortar becomes stronger than the surrounding masonry, trapping moisture and causing spalling, cracking, and structural deterioration.

Masonry Repair and Brick Repointing Alexandria Virginia

Proper Repointing Requires Experience

Brick masonry restoration is one of the most misunderstood construction trades in Northern Virginia.

Many inexperienced contractors simply grind out joints and apply modern mortar without understanding how moisture movement affects older masonry structures.

A true master mason understands that successful brick repointing involves:

  • Matching mortar strength properly
  • Preserving moisture movement
  • Preventing trapped water conditions
  • Maintaining structural integrity
  • Understanding thermal expansion
  • Protecting aging brick surfaces


Improper repointing work may initially look attractive but can eventually destroy the surrounding brickwork.

Historic Alexandria structures require careful restoration techniques designed to preserve both appearance and long-term durability.

Basement Flooding and Waterproofing Alexandria Virginia

Understanding Alexandria’s Problematic Soil Conditions

Many Alexandria homes are built on difficult soil conditions that contribute to water intrusion, settlement, hydrostatic pressure, and foundation movement.

Certain areas contain clay-heavy soils that expand and contract dramatically depending on moisture levels.

These soils place enormous pressure against basement walls and foundations over time.

Combined with aging drainage systems and older construction methods, these soil conditions frequently lead to basement flooding and moisture problems throughout Alexandria City.


Common Basement Water Problems


Hydrostatic Pressure

Water pressure building against foundation walls can eventually force moisture through cracks, joints, and porous concrete surfaces.

Surface Water Drainage Failures

Improper grading or clogged drainage systems may direct water directly toward the foundation.

Foundation Cracking

Settlement and soil movement can create structural cracks that allow water intrusion.

Older Waterproofing Failures

Many older Alexandria homes were built before modern waterproofing systems existed.

Foundation Repair Alexandria Virginia

Structural Stabilization and Long-Term Protection

Foundation problems in Alexandria are often directly connected to moisture movement and problematic soil conditions.

Expansive clay soils can shift foundations over time, causing:

  • Horizontal cracks
  • Stair-step brick cracking
  • Bowing walls
  • Uneven floors
  • Structural settlement
  • Water intrusion

Installing Windows in Brick Walls Alexandria Virginia

Structural Knowledge Matters

Installing a new window opening into an existing brick wall is a highly technical process requiring structural understanding and careful execution.

Improper installation can compromise structural integrity, create water intrusion problems, or damage historic masonry.

Cecco Construction understands how to safely cut and reinforce brick wall openings while protecting surrounding masonry systems.


Window Opening Installation Process

Structural Evaluation

The wall must first be evaluated to determine load-bearing conditions and support requirements.


Lintel Installation

Steel or engineered lintels are installed to properly transfer structural loads above the new opening.


Controlled Masonry Cutting

Precision cutting techniques help minimize cracking and preserve surrounding brickwork.

Waterproofing Integration

Proper flashing and moisture control systems prevent future water intrusion.

Many Alexandria homes contain older multi-wythe brick walls and historical masonry systems that require specialized knowledge during modification.

Installing a window incorrectly into these structures can lead to settlement cracks, moisture problems, or long-term masonry failure.
